Many years ago, around 1900, social customes were very different from what they are today. if a young man wanted to make a formal call on a young lady, the custom of the day wasd to approach the young lady's house and present a card of introduction. Generally, a servant or butler would offer a server, or silver plate, upon wich the young man would place the card. Then the young lady would be called upon to greet the young man. In this story two young men dress up in their best with the intention of calling upon two sisters - but things don't go as expected for them, and their shyness doesn't make things any easier. This was first printed in MCall's Magazine in 1906.
